Product Description

CHO‑SEAL 1501 is a high‑performance conductive elastomer developed by Parker Chomerics to deliver superior EMI and EMP shielding in demanding applications. Crafted with a silicone binder and filled with pure silver particles, this material offers robust electromagnetic protection with a volume resistivity of just 0.033 Ω·cm as supplied, no conductive adhesive required. Its shielding effectiveness is impressive: ≥ 100 dB at both 100 MHz and 500 MHz (E‑field), ≥ 90 dB at 2 GHz, and ≥ 80 dB at 10 GHz, all tested to MIL‑G‑83528 standards. Mechanically, CHO‑SEAL 1501 is soft and flexible, with a Shore A hardness between 28 and 42. It features a tensile strength of at least 0.552 MPa (≈ 80 psi), tear strength of 3.50 kN/m and a compression set of 80% after 70 hours at 100 °C (ASTM D395 Method B). Thermally, it operates reliably up to around 160–200 °C, making it suitable for high‑temperature environments. For EMP shielding, it sustains survivability at up to 0.3 kA per inch perimeter, while retaining good resilience under vibration (resistance post‑vibration: 0.03 Ω·cm max).
